Output 3d40b59131d6ab02c9f523f28c61087dbed0e5e81bd3c86c53ce2053e49794fd:2

value
74270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01090a1c5ab123b303197e624d1c9458d8b70cef OP_EQUAL
address
31nVRoyWX9g67Hbn7kRDuNnsRNUZnwGAMj
transaction
3d40b59131d6ab02c9f523f28c61087dbed0e5e81bd3c86c53ce2053e49794fd
spent
true